Why Is August Still a Busy Month for PCS Moves?
PCS season typically runs from May 15 through August 31, with June and July as the heaviest months. August still carries a steady share of moves, especially for families timing their relocation around the start of the school year so kids can begin fresh in the fall rather than partway through a semester. That means transportation offices, moving companies, and rental markets near military installations stay busy right through the end of the month.
What Should I Do Before I Arrive in San Antonio?
A little preparation before your move can make in-processing and settling in go more smoothly.
Confirm your housing timeline. If you are on a waitlist for on-post housing or still deciding between on-post and off-post living, know your move-in date range before you arrive.
Research off-post neighborhoods early. Converse offers a shorter commute to Randolph AFB and Fort Sam Houston than many neighborhoods further into San Antonio, without giving up access to shopping, dining, and schools.
Check school enrollment requirements. If you have school-age children, most Converse addresses fall within Judson ISD, so confirm your zoned campus and any enrollment paperwork needed for a mid-year or fall start.
